    Notes: Generalized fluid models have become increasingly popular for incorporating kinetic effects in hydrodynamic studies of laser–plasma interactions. However, their transport coefficients depend on the source of the thermal perturbation, which leads to difficulties, since both inverse-bremsstrahlung heating and pdV work drive these perturbations. Treating these sources separately using a model with two energy equations is proposed. Tested against electron Fokker–Planck simulations, this model reproduces both Landau damping of ion-sound waves and the correct response to inverse bremsstrahlung.
